From 1991 – 1993 scientists embarked on a bold mission to replicate the world’s biological systems in an enclosed facility called Biosphere II. The Arizona-based experiment included a crew that lived in the “closed world” for two years. The crew grew their own food, did experiments, learned how to function together (that part of the mission did not go so well) and they tried to replicate the natural environment of plants and the other building blocks of life.
